Как узнать, находится ли MediaRecorder в рабочем состоянии или нет?

Я написал код для записи аудио разговора с использованием MediaRecorder.

Как узнать, находится ли MediaRecorder в рабочем состоянии или нет, чтобы остановить запись. например,

boolean running;
MediaRecorder mr;
//what should i assign to running?        
if(running){
   mr.stop()
}

Выше приведен только пример кода. Если вы не понимаете мой вопрос, пожалуйста, скажите мне .. Я четко объясню с реальным кодом ..

Что я хочу знать, так это «В каком состоянии MediaRecorder является?" -> запись / выпуск / подготовка / начальная / и т. д.

10
задан Jonas 15 August 2011 в 20:23
поделиться